Namasto – Indisches Restaurant in Jena Namasto ist Ihr indisches Restaurant in Jena in der Wagnergasse. Wir servieren authentische indische Spezialitäten mit traditionellen Gewürzen und frischen Zutaten. Genießen Sie aromatische Currys, Butter Chicken, Tandoori-Gerichte, Biryani, Naan sowie vegetarische und vegane Speisen. Ob gemütlich vor Ort, zum Mitnehmen oder als Lieferservice in Jena – bestellen Sie bequem online über unsere Website. Unser beliebter Mittagstisch bietet täglich frische indische Gerichte im Herzen von Jena.

Premsagar Rao
Great food! I would call it the best Indian restaurant in Jena.
Chicken Vindaloo was really good, and the naans were really soft and delicious as well, they made me feel like I was back home. Quantity was enough for one person, and the naan provided with the Gerichte is actually quite big with 4 large pieces.
Lamm Biryani also tasted very nice, although the preparation was more akin to a Tawa Pulao rather than a Biryani.
Mango Lassi was amazingly refreshing and delicious.
Overall, really liked it and I plan to visit regularly!
